     Dorothy Emelia Timonen Kiiskila, 88, born April 10, 1935, and passed away November 19, 2023, at Canal View -- Houghton County in Hancock, Michigan, where she was a resident patient since June 2023.

     Dorothy was also a resident of Tapiola, Michigan.

     Her parents were Charles and Emelia (Hyypio) Herrala of Tapiola.

     Also preceding her in death were her husband Reino Timonen of 47 years, son Daniel Timonen, and son-in-law Donald Harry. 

     Surviving Dorothy are her children: Mark (Ruth) Timonen of Tapiola, Maryann Harry of Appleton, Wisconsin, Susanna (Tim) Gaffin of Grand Rapids, Michigan, Rebekah (Rick) Kasprzak of Calumet, Michigan, and Timothy (Karen) Timonen of Tapiola; her daughter-in-law: Kathy Timonen of Texas.  Dorothy has fifteen grandchildren, eighteen great-grandchildren and one great-great-grandson.

     A celebration of her life memorial service will take place at the Doelle Senior Citizen Center in Tapiola, Michigan, Saturday, December 2, 2023, at 2:00 pm.

     A spring interment and memorial service will take place at the Elo Cemetery in Late May 2024.

     The family wishes to thank the staff at Canal View for their kindness and care of Dorothy.
